Mini Split Line Set Installation Guide
Wiki Article

Successfully connecting your mini split line set demands careful attention to detail. This guide will walk you through the process, guiding you in achieving a seamless and efficient installation. First, gather your tools and materials, including refrigerant lines, electrical wire, insulation, and proper safety equipment. Next, carefully measure the distance between the indoor and outdoor units, indicating the path for the line set.
- Drill holes through walls or ceilings to accommodate the refrigerant lines. Remember to follow local building codes and safety regulations throughout the process.
- Fish the refrigerant lines through the holes, using a fish tape if necessary. Insulate the lines with appropriate insulation material to prevent heat loss or gain.
- Attach the refrigerant lines to the indoor and outdoor units by employing the proper fittings and sealant. Verify all connections are secure and leak-free.
- Connect the electrical wiring, following the manufacturer's instructions carefully.
- Fill the system with refrigerant according to the manufacturer's specifications. Inspect the system for leaks and proper operation.
Upon installation is complete, remove any debris and check the entire system for functionality. Congratulations! You have successfully fitted your mini split line set.Refer to the manufacturer's manual for ongoing maintenance and support.
Choosing the Right HVAC Line Set
Selecting and sizing your HVAC line set correctly is crucial for optimal system function. A correctly sized line set ensures adequate refrigerant flow, maintaining proper temperature control and preventing strain on your HVAC system.
- Consider factors like your home's size, insulation level, climate zone, and the BTU rating of your air conditioner or heat pump.
- Utilize manufacturer recommendations for line set length and diameter requirements.
- Use a refrigeration charge tool to determine the precise refrigerant amount needed for your system.
Improper line set installation can lead to reduced cooling or heating output, increased energy consumption, and premature unit failure. By prioritizing accurate determination of your HVAC line set, you can ensure long-lasting, efficient performance.
Linking Your Mini-Split System
When deploying your mini-split system, the lineset is a crucial element. This flexible copper tube runs refrigerant between the indoor and outdoor units. Properly linking the lineset ensures efficient heat exchange and optimal system performance. Before, carefully measure the length required based on your room layout. Then, adhere to the manufacturer's instructions for locating the units and trimming the lineset. Securely connect the refrigerant lines using proper tools. Remember to wrap the lineset for maximum efficiency.
